If you cannot commit to or afford inpatient or residential rehab there are outpatient options that are more intensive than normal outpatient care, such as outpatient day treatment that is also at times called partial hospitalization. The most obvious difference is that individuals do not stay at the center like with inpatient, and go home after rehab each day. Outpatient day treatment or partial hospitalization typically entails treatment services being offered at least five days per week, for up to 8 hrs per day. Aside from this option being used as a main rehab option, outpatient day treatment or partial hospitalization can also assist clients who have completed inpatient treatment transition back into a sober way of life.
Rehab services include standard rehabilitation services such as individual counseling and group therapy, but there are also relapse prevention elements in place such as psychotherapies that are known to help prevent destructive behaviors and inspire people to remain sober and get treatment. For people having trouble with a co-occurring mental health issues, many outpatient day treatment or partial hospitalization centers also offer care for dual diagnosis.
